He and his sister Mary grew up in Ohio, where he was a member of the class of 1957 at Grandview Heights High School. After graduation and Army service, he attended Ohio State University, Ohio Technical Institute, and Nova University.
In 1967 he moved to the Tampa Bay Area and began work as a technical writer at Honeywell. He remained in Technical Publications until his retirement in 2005.
Ralph and his wife Anne have lived in Palm Harbor for 43 years. He is also survived by a son, Jon (and wife Tiffany) of Kearsarge, New Hampshire, and two granddaughters, Heather and Alison.
Ralph had many interests, including bag piping, tennis, cross stitch, and SCUBA. After retirement he became skilled working with stained glass. He served on the Board of the Miniature Art Society of Florida. Ralph was also very active in his church community. He was a member of Lutheran Church of the Palms where he served several terms as president and then treasurer; later he was a member of Grace Lutheran Church in Clearwater and was their bookkeeper for many years.
He passed away unexpectedly on April 16. He will be remembered for his quick wit and generous heart.
